
AXA-backed company acquires Dylon
AXA Private Equity portfolio company Spotless Group has acquired producer of fabric dyes and colours Dylon International Ltd from the Mayborn Group for an undisclosed sum.
AXA PE created the Spotless group in 2005. The company is a European producer and distributor of home care and cleaning products. Since its inception, Spotless, has since completed seven acquisitions and predicts a turnover of EUR370m in 2008. Dylon will become part of Spotless Punch UK.
Dylon was founded in 1946 as Dyes of London. It focuses on fabric dyes and household products,, which are produced under the Dylon LS, Lord Sheraton and Oust brands.
